Streaks: The Powerful Habit You Can’t Quit & How Medial’s Glitch Proved It 💯 Have you ever wondered why so many apps use streaks to keep you coming back day after day? Yesterday, Medial faced a technical glitch that reset everyone’s streaks back to 1 and the wave of frustration and sadness showed just how much these streaks truly matter. Here’s why streaks work so well: 1. Psychological Commitment: Building a streak creates a small daily goal that quickly becomes a habit. The longer your streak, the more motivated you are to keep it going nobody wants to lose progress they’ve worked hard for. 2. Instant Motivation: Your streak number acts like a visible badge of dedication. It’s a simple, powerful reminder that encourages you to open the app every single day, even if only for a moment. 3. Fear of Loss: Losing a streak triggers a strong emotional response. It feels worse to lose your streak than to gain a new one, which keeps users coming back to avoid that loss. Medial’s streak reset glitch was a perfect example of this in action. Users didn’t just feel mildly annoyed many were genuinely upset and eager to see their streaks restored. That’s how deeply streaks connect with our motivation and daily habits. So, next time you open an app just to keep your streak alive, remember: it’s not just habit it’s a smart design that taps into your drive for progress, consistency, and avoiding loss. genius right ! 🌝👑
